Which is the most important factor in determining a safe vessel speed on any given day?

The most important factor that one should determine in safe vessel speed on any given day is to be made aware of the conditions in terms of visibility. Example of these would be the darkness, rain, mist or fog. Another thing is to check weather conditions and the currents of the water to determine speed for your boat as you head to the water.
